February 15-16, the Southern University Track and Field team attended the Mike Williams Saluki USA Track and Field Open, held at the University of Southern Illinois at Carbondale.
“This was the perfect meet for us to participate in leading into SWAC,” said head coach Johnny Thomas.
With 23 schools in attendance, SU was the only Southwestern Athletic Conference representative, and this was just the type of competition needed going into the Indoor SWAC championship, this weekend.
“I am confident with my performance because I am peaking at the right time,” said Erica Lattin.
Lattin is indeed peaking at the right time. Her performance in the 55-meter dash put her in sixth place with a time of 7.25. In the 200-meter, she finished with a time of 26.06.
Francella Williams also continues to do well. She placed first in 55-meter hurdles with 8.22 as her finishing time.
Southern placed third in the 4×400 relay with 3:39.31 and the distance medley relay with 13.06 time.
The girls’ middle distance runners Shahaja Pitre, Aisha Harris, Erikka Thomas, Rayla Hunt and Kenya Warren have also continued to progress.
“I felt I ran strong in the distance medley relay and my time dropped in the 400 however, I still want to drop my time in all my events,” said Aisha Harris.
Kashanna Bridges had a jump of 4.71m in the long jump competition and Danielle Frank had a 4.93m jump participating in the long jump, for the first time this year.
In the hammer throw, Carole Mitchell had a personal best throw of 10.39m, Danielle Frank threw 10.98m and Tia Mills threw11.10m.
“With the SWAC championship meet in our back yard I feel that we are fully prepared,” said team member Joseph Shelton.
The Men’s A-team placed second in the 4×400 with a 3:18.28 time. The B team placed fifth with a time of 3:22.99 time. The men also placed first in the distance medley relay with time of 10:37.21.
In the 200, there were eleven runners participating from Southern, with six placing in the top ten.
In the 400 Kevin Harris placed fifth with 49.22 time, in the 600 Che Kamani’s 1:26.43 placed him in sixth.
“Going into SWAC we are looking to defend our title and we should be very successful at that,” said Devin Daniels.
The Indoor Track SWAC Championship will be held February 23-24 at Louisiana State University.
